在网络世界中,VLAN(Virtual Local Area Network,虚拟局域网)是一种常见的网络技术,它将物理网络划分为多个逻辑网络,从而提高网络的安全性和可管理性。然而,VLAN并非万能,它也存在一些漏洞,可能会被恶意攻击者利用。本文将深入探讨VLAN漏洞的攻击风险与防范策略。
VLAN漏洞攻击风险
1. VLAN hopping(VLAN跳转)
VLAN hopping是一种常见的攻击方式,攻击者通过欺骗交换机,使得未授权的流量可以跨越VLAN边界。以下是几种常见的VLAN hopping攻击方法:
- 动态VLAN分配攻击:攻击者通过伪造的DHCP请求,获取到交换机分配的VLAN ID,从而访问其他VLAN的流量。
- 静态VLAN分配攻击:攻击者通过伪造的MAC地址,将交换机的端口配置为其他VLAN,从而访问其他VLAN的流量。
- Double Tagging攻击:攻击者发送带有两个VLAN标签的帧,欺骗交换机认为这是一个合法的帧,从而访问其他VLAN的流量。
2. VLAN Trunking Protocol(VTP)攻击
VTP是一种用于在交换机之间共享VLAN信息的协议。VTP攻击者可以通过篡改VTP信息,使得其他交换机学习到错误的VLAN配置,从而实现攻击。
3. VLAN ID泄露
当交换机与外部网络通信时,可能会泄露VLAN ID信息,攻击者可以通过这些信息推断出网络结构,从而进行针对性的攻击。
VLAN漏洞防范策略
1. 限制VLAN访问
- 端口安全:为每个端口设置最大MAC地址数量,防止攻击者通过伪造MAC地址进行攻击。
- VLAN访问控制列表(ACL):限制不同VLAN之间的通信,防止未授权的流量跨越VLAN边界。
2. 优化VTP配置
- 关闭VTP:在安全要求较高的网络中,建议关闭VTP,避免VTP攻击。
- 限制VTP域:将VTP域限制在最小范围内,减少攻击面。
3. 保护VLAN ID
- 隐藏VLAN ID:在交换机配置中,隐藏VLAN ID信息,防止攻击者获取网络结构。
- 限制VLAN ID范围:为每个端口指定VLAN ID范围,防止攻击者通过伪造VLAN ID进行攻击。
4. 其他防护措施
- 使用802.1X认证:为交换机端口启用802.1X认证,防止未授权的设备接入网络。
- 定期更新设备固件:及时更新交换机固件,修复已知漏洞。
总结
VLAN技术在提高网络安全性和可管理性方面发挥着重要作用,但同时也存在一些漏洞。网络工程师需要了解VLAN漏洞的攻击风险,并采取相应的防范措施,以确保网络的安全稳定。通过本文的介绍,相信您对VLAN漏洞有了更深入的了解,能够更好地保护您的网络。
